Subject: Log compaction window for Quillbus

Hi team,

Heads up for the next release: Quillbus log compaction now runs nightly at 02:00 UTC, so partner consumers must tolerate offset gaps after compaction. No schema changes. To validate your consumers against the compacted staging topics, authenticate with the bearer token below.

session JWT of yawep-yawep = eyJhbGciOiJIUzI1NiIsInR5cCI6IkpXVCJ9.eyJzdWIiOiI3pWF3_In0.aXYsHiog

Subject: DR drill — Brindlekit versioning

Reviewers: during Friday's disaster-recovery drill we'll restore the Brindlekit component library registry from backup. Hold approvals on any PR that bumps a Brindlekit major version until the drill ends, since restored metadata may lag. To verify the restored registry afterward, run the integrity check, which will request the phrase below.

vault phrase of yagag-kadup = belael-druius-rusax-kelox

Handover — export retries

Hi, taking over from me tonight: the Ledgerline export worker has been failing intermittently since the storage migration. Failed exports land in the dead-letter queue and must be retried manually with the replay script; do not retry more than three at once or the downstream importer stalls. Check queue depth before and after each batch. The worker currently runs with these settings.

settings of bafof-fajog:
[aldix]
port = 9300
region = north-3
host = aldix.kelvilabs.example
team = istath
timeout_ms = 1500
retries = 8

## Support

This branch migrates Quillbase from ad-hoc shell builds to the Stonejar hermetic toolchain. All dependencies are now pinned in the lockfile; no network access during builds. Reviewers: verify the vendored toolchain hashes match the manifest and that no rule reads from the host environment. Known gap: the docs target still shells out to a system binary; tracked separately. Build times roughly doubled on first run, cached thereafter. For questions during review, reach the build infrastructure team at the address below.

escalation mailbox, bafog-fafog: ulador@paliqlabs.internal